I heard if you go to 1:6 rocker ratio it will increase your valve lift.Is this true?Is this a straight bolt on? or do you have to change other stuff too.

iroc22
12-21-2003, 09:42 PM
Yeah it will increase your camshaft lift since the stock ratio is 1.6 It is a straight bolt on, however watch that you get the proper rockers since 88-up use self aligning rocker arms.

you may have to change springs - depends which ones you have.

Duration will not be affected

Total lobe duration doesn't change of course, and .050 duration at the lifter, where it's rated doesn't change, but the valve gets to the original .075 lift point (based on 1.5 ratio and .050 lobe lift) a little sooner
